Handyman repair services encompass a wide range of practical solutions for everyday home maintenance and small-scale repair needs. These services typically involve fixing minor issues such as leaky faucets, squeaky doors, broken fixtures, or damaged drywall. They can also include tasks like installing shelves, hanging pictures, assembling furniture, or replacing door locks. By addressing these small but important repairs, handyman services help maintain the safety, functionality, and appearance of a property, making it more comfortable and efficient for residents.

Many common problems around the home can be resolved through handyman repair services. These include issues like clogged drains, loose cabinet hinges, cracked tiles, and malfunctioning electrical outlets. Service providers can also handle more specialized tasks such as drywall patching, painting touch-ups, or installing new hardware. These repairs often arise unexpectedly or as part of routine upkeep, and having access to local pros ensures that homeowners can quickly restore their home’s condition without the need for multiple contractors or complex arrangements.

The overview below groups typical Handyman Repair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ine repairs like fixing leaky faucets or patching drywall usually range from $150 to $600. Many common jobs fall within this middle range, making it a popular choice for local pros handling straightforward tasks.

Medium Projects - More involved projects such as cabinet installation or appliance hookups often cost between $600 and $2,500. These projects are common and represent the bulk of handyman work, with some larger jobs reaching higher amounts.

Large-Scale Repairs - Larger or more complex repairs, like roof patching or extensive carpentry, can cost from $2,500 to $5,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this high-cost tier, but local contractors are equipped to handle these jobs as needed.

Full Replacement - Complete replacements, such as installing new windows or replacing a door, typically range from $1,000 to $5,000 depending on size and materials. These projects are less frequent but are well within the capabilities of experienced service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
